Diva Power: Newfound Respect

You know it’s a tenant’s market (see main feature) when someone who last year reportedly couldn’t find a place, on account of a bad credit reputation, gets approved for a $65,000 two-week rental. Then again, celebrities are different from you and me: The tenant in question is Aretha Franklin, and the owner is hotelier Ricky Hilton, who presumably knows something about getting guests to pay up. That hefty price brings access to an ocean beach and a private three-acre lawn patrolled by 24-hour guards – security measures surely appreciated by her Fordune neighbors, such as Anna Murdoch and Millennium Partners honcho Chris Jeffries. (Pat Petrillo at Sotheby’s brokered the deal but was unavailable for comment.) Even considering the mushy market, though, Ms. Franklin’s royal status certainly helped her case: Doesn’t the Queen of Soul deserve a palace?
